2019-2020 Ford Fusion PHEV Battery Fires & Battery Failures
Ford’s Fusion hybrids are being recalled over battery failure, fires, and sudden engine failures
Lieff Cabraser is investigating complaints that a recent safety recall for 2019-2020 Ford Fusion plug-in hybrid electric vehicles has left owners and lessees with vehicles they cannot safely charge. This defect leads to an increase in fuel costs and poses severe safety risks that increase the risk of a crash and injury. The recall warns drivers that the high voltage batteries in their hybrid vehicles can cause a vehicle fire or cause a sudden loss of power while the vehicle is in motion.
